    5 out of 5 stars Shows LP's versatility   July 28, 2004
    3 out of 4 found this review helpful

    As Linkin Park's last single off their amazing sophmore album, Meteora, Breaking The Habit is an amazing choice for a single. This song is soft, heartfelt, and beautiful. The lyrics have caused controversy as to what they mean for over a year, and make people think. Even though this song is soft, I challenge people to then listen to Lmore of LP's music and realize how versitile they really are. Linkin Park's music can be hard rock to the soft techo melody in this song, and their lyrics can be simply stated or dizzying. These are just some of the reasons Linkin Park is my favorite band and I encourage others not to judge them by one song or what haters may say, but by listening to more of their music and finding out if LP can help you like its helped thousands of fans that are in the fanclub with me.


    5 out of 5 stars Great Single   June 22, 2004
    Guy Brown
    3 out of 4 found this review helpful

    Probably the best single since In The End, the song does seem a little more creative, with live strings and no rap, and pretty good writing to go along, the is definitely more interesting then In The End, going to cartoon and not live, it's really well done. I think even people that hate Linkin Park, will like something about this single.
